Kearny HS students rescued trapped fish after Hurricane Sandy

 

Photo courtesy of David Paszkiewicz In the aftermath of Sandy, Gunnel Oval was flooded. When the storm surge receded, fish were trapped on the ball fields with no way back to the marsh. Members of the KHS Fishing Club, dawning waders and fishing nets, rescued 76 Carp and brought them back to the marsh. The average weight of each fish was 7lbs and the club estimates a total of 532lbs of fish rescued.
